Abstract;This research aims at the realization a new transmission for bicycles using pneumatic power. The step pedal which was shown in previous report is improved. And the energy regeneration function which changed kinematic energy to air pressure when the brake is put on and which was stored was carried. This paper shows the principle of the energy regeneration function and the outdoors experiment. (author abst.)
